Worst outage events on record
| Date | Duration | Customers affected | Cause |
|---|---|---|---|
| Jan 21, 2020 | 1 hrs | 8,205 (56%) | Unnamed event |
| Mar 29, 2020 | 9 hrs | 3,157 (21%) | Unnamed event |
| Nov 5, 2022 | 6 hrs | 2,943 (20%) | Dense Fog |
| Feb 7, 2020 | 2 hrs | 2,687 (18%) | Unnamed event |
| Nov 2, 2022 | 1 hrs | 2,629 (18%) | Dense Fog |
Over the 9 years from 2017 to 2025, Spencer County recorded 330 distinct power outage events, averaging 2.4 hours per event.
The single worst outage on record in Spencer County started January 21, 2020, lasting 1 hours and leaving up to 8,205 customers without power (56% of the county) at its peak.
July has historically been the worst month for outages in Spencer County, with 48 events recorded during that month across the dataset.
Based on this history, Spencer County earns a Reliability Grade of B, placing it in the 76th percentile nationally for grid reliability (higher percentile = more reliable).
